Pattaya is a beautiful city in Thailand, famous for more than just its nightlife. Situated 149 km away from Bangkok, this city also has serene beaches to help relax and escape the hustle and bustle of the crowds. 2. Pattaya Beach: Party Destination

View of Pattaya City with Pattaya Beach

In contrast to the Jomtien Beach, Pattaya beach is more of a party beach. This main beach of the city has a crescent-shaped coast that stretches for 4 km. Pattaya beach at night is always filled with people as crowds gather to party here at the beach bars and clubs.

Highlights: Shacks,beach side resorts and hotels

Things To Do: Parasailing, jet skiing, banana boat rides, sunbathing, nightlife hopping

Best For: Party lovers, first-time visitors, nightlife enthusiasts

3. Naklua Beach: Quiet Shores With A Local Touch

Sanctuary of Truth at Nakluea Beach, Pattaya

Naklua Beach situated in the northern part of Pattaya offers a glimpse into Pattaya’s quieter side. The beach is home to many fishing activities, hence a great place to understand the local fishing culture.  This secluded beach with beautiful seaside views makes for a great pick.
Highlights:
Fishing boats, seafood stalls, serene environment
Things To Do:
Swimming, photography, seafood dining, calm beach walks
Best For:
Peace seekers, culture lovers and leisurely travelers

8. Bang Saray Beach: Marine Life And Tranquil Shores

The fishing village of Bang Saray, Pattaya

Another famous beach in south of Pattaya sheltered away from the city’s buzz is Bang Saray Beach.

Bang Saray Beach is popular for spotting whale sharks and peaceful fishing scenes. This is also where you can spot the ruins of a cargo ship that sank during World War II.
Highlights: Whale shark sightings, WWII shipwreck, fishing piers
Things To Do: Scuba diving, fishing, visiting nearby attractions
Best For: Marine enthusiasts, scuba divers, offbeat travellers

FAQs

When is the best time of year to visit beaches in Pattaya?

November to February is the best time to visit Pattaya beaches. During these months the temperature is pleasant as humidity level is low. It is a great time to indulge in water activities.

Which Pattaya beach is best for families with kids?

Jomtien Beach is considered as the most family-friendly beach in Pattaya. The calm and clean water here is great for kids.

Which Pattaya beach is best for couples and honeymooners?

Koh Larn and Wong Amat Beach are the best beaches in Pattaya for couples as they are less crowded and has scenic views.

Is Pattaya Beach good for swimming?

Pattaya Beach is generally not considered good for swimming. Key reasons for this are, high boat traffic, poor water quality and dangerous currents. Its best suited for water sports activities.
